EBook Description: In a relatively short period of time Data Envelopment Analysis (DEA) has grown into a powerful quantitative, analytical tool for measuring and evaluating performance. It has been successfully applied to a host of different entities engaged in a wide variety of activities in many contexts worldwide. In many cases evaluations of these entities have been resistant to other approaches because complex, multiple levels of (often) poorly understood relations must be considered. A few examples of these multifaceted problems are (1) maintenance activities of US Air Force bases in geographically dispersed locations, (2) police force efficiencies in the United Kingdom, (3) branch bank performances in Canada, Cyprus, and other countries and (4) the efficiency of universities in performing their education and research functions in the U.S., England, and France. In addition to localized problems, DEA applications have been extended to performance evaluations of `larger entities' such as cities, regions, and countries.

Data analysis for hyphenated techniques
Based on a concrete set of working MATLAB programs, the book begins with a short program of snippets describing basic principles and proceeds to a complete application program filling a central analytical need: obtaining pure spectra from the observed overlapping spectra, with standard deviations for the solutions obtained. The strength of the book is the open nature of the programs. All programs can be read, tested and modified by the user. The mathematical principles needed for the proper treatment of experimental data are thoroughly described. The first part of the book describes how data is collected, converted and prepared for the actual deconvolution. Practical working algorithms such as the Savitzky-Golay smoothing method are emphasized. The reader can see how searches in spectral libraries can be greatly speeded up by proper formulation of the calculation. Basic signal processing is described by illustrative examples. The main part of the book describes the deconvolution of overlapping chromatographic peaks. Principle component analysis is described and used as a useful tool. The main emphasis is a discussion of a deconvolution method, OSCAR (Optimization by Stepwise Constraining of Alternating Regression), developed by the authors. The results can be validated as OSCAR calculates confidence intervals for the spectra and elution curves.
Categorical Data Analysis Using the SAS System
Statisticians and researchers will find this book auseful discussion of categorical data analysis techniques as well as an invaluable aid in applying these methods with the SAS System. Practical examples from a broad range of applications illustrate the use of the FREQ, LOGISTIC, GENMOD, and CATMOD procedures in a variety of analyses. Other procedures discussed include the PHREG and NPAR1WAY procedures. Topics discussed include assessing association in contingency tables and sets of tables, logistic regression and conditional logistic regression, weighted least squares modeling, repeated measurements analyses, loglinear models, and bioassay analysis. The second edition has been revised for use with Version 8 of the SAS System. New topics include additional exact tests, generalized estimating equations, use of the CLASS statement in the LOGISTIC procedure, exact logistic regression using the LOGISTIC procedure, and comparisons of the use of subject-specific models versus population-averaged models.

Exploratory Data Analysis Using Fisher Information
The basic goal of a research scientist is to understand a given, unknown system. This innovative book develops a systematic approach for achieving this goal. All science is ultimately dependent upon observation which, in turn, requires a flow of information. Fisher information, in particular, is found to provide the key to understanding the system. It is developed as a new tool of exploratory data analysis, and is applied to a wide scope of systems problems. These range from molecules in a gas to biological organisms in their ecologies, to the socio-economic organization of people in their societies, to the physical constants in the universe and, ultimately, to proto-universes in the multiverse. Examples of system input-output laws discovered by the approach include the famous quarter-power laws of biology and the Tobin q-theory of optimized economic investment. System likelihood laws that can be determined include the probability density functions defining in situ cancer growth and a wide class of systems (thermodynamic, economic, cryptographic) obeying Schrodinger-like equations. Novel uncertainty principles in the fields of biology and economics are also found to hold.
